Summary Summary:
The Sr. Engineer - PL Integrity coordinates, implements, and executes pipeline integrity management projects for intrastate and interstate liquid and natural gas pipelines. This position reports to the Manager of Pipeline Integrity.
Essential Duties and Responsibilities:
Performs project management duties for inline inspection projects and other projects as assigned. Works with ILI service providers including coordinating ILI bid packages, selection, evaluation, and award. Develops and maintains inline inspection and integrity testing schedules. Submits proposed projects to support execution of the company Integrity Management Plan ensuring compliance with all federal and state pipeline safety regulations. Analyzes ILI data with communication and coordination of pipeline repair activities in response to ILI anomalies. Manages the Integrity Management Plan requirements for HCA areas. Performs threat and risk analysis. Advises engineering and construction groups to facilitate long term operation, maintenance, and assessment of newly installed or retrofitted facilities. Interacts with other integrity engineers, the corrosion group, operations, liquid & gas control, and GIS group on a regular basis for efficient implementation of the pipeline integrity plan. Must be able to operate Microsoft Office applications and other personal computer-based applications for gathering, integrating, analyzing, and reporting pipeline integrity related data.
